Two Specialized Fields

Students choose any two fields, in each of which they will take at least two courses. The specialized fields are:

Courses taken in the Core Field may not be double-counted in a specialized field.

Students must receive permission from the Program Director to apply other courses towards a field.

Undergraduate courses listed may fulfill graduate requirements only upon approval of the professor and the program director, and agreement on additional work necessary to raise the course to graduate level. The professors in question have been alerted that graduate students may be taking their undergraduate courses and are favorably disposed to granting approval. Petition forms for this are available in the Academic Advising Office on the third floor of the Elliott School of International Affairs.
